/[gentoo-src]/rc-scripts/ChangeLog
Gentoo

Diff of /rc-scripts/ChangeLog

Parent Directory Parent Directory | Revision Log Revision Log | View Patch Patch

Revision 1.281 Revision 1.292
1# ChangeLog for Gentoo Linux System Intialization ("rc") scripts 1# ChangeLog for Gentoo Linux System Intialization ("rc") scripts
2# Copyright 2002-2003 Gentoo Technologies, Inc.; Distributed under the GPL 2# Copyright 2002-2003 Gentoo Technologies, Inc.; Distributed under the GPL
3# Written by Daniel Robbins (drobbins@gentoo.org) 3# Written by Daniel Robbins (drobbins@gentoo.org)
4
5 29 Oct 2003; Martin Schlemmer <azarah@gentoo.org>:
6
7 We should still use /sbin/udev as hotplug agent if /sbin/hotplug do
8 not exist. Updated /sbin/rc for this.
9
10 Add a fix to /etc/init.d/keymaps for bug #32111 (we should not have
11 '-u' in the call to loadkeys when using unicode).
12
13 We should not use '-' in variable names for bash, bug #31184, thanks
14 to Andreas Simon <yuipx@gmx.net>. Updated /sbin/MAKEDEV.
15
16 27 Oct 2003; Martin Schlemmer <azarah@gentoo.org>:
17
18 Fix return code checking of fsck in /etc/init.d/checkfs, bug #31349.
19
20 26 Oct 2003; Martin Schlemmer <azarah@gentoo.org>:
21
22 The unmount stuff in /etc/init.d/halt.sh was flawed, in the fact that
23 it called 'umount -t no<insert_fs_here>', which resulted in /proc, etc
24 unmounted anyhow. Change it to remount the last filesystems readonly
25 without trying to unmount any. This fixes a few cases where reboot
26 would halt due to unmounted /proc, etc.
27
28 This change set fixes two things:
29 1) In exporting all functions/variables in functions.sh, rc-services.sh
30 and rc-daemon.sh, we created an overly large environment, and also
31 broke stuff like glftpd. Do not do this, and hope whatever caused
32 the issues previously is fixed in the meantime. This should close
33 bugs #25754 and #31794.
34 2) gendepend.awk used to generate deptree with functions called
35 depinfo_<scriptname> which set appropriate variables when called.
36 This broke if the scriptname contained characters that is not valid
37 for bash variable names. Changed things to use an array fixing this.
38 This closes bug #24092.
39
40 Change /sbin/rc again to not set the hotplug agent to /sbin/udev, as
41 /sbin/hotplug will call udev as well.
42
43 Fix a logic error in /lib/rcscripts/sh/rc-services.sh that cause the
44 get_dep_info() function to skip the last entry in the RC_DEPEND_TREE
45 array (in my case 'net').
46
47 We did not handle the 'net' dependency properly in valid_iuse() and
48 valid_iafter(). Fix this in /lib/rcscripts/sh/rc-services.sh, closing
49 bugs #30327 and #31950.
50
51 Change an occurance of /etc/modutils in modules-update.8 to
52 /etc/modules.d/ closing bug #31171.
4 53
5 19 Oct 2003; Martin Schlemmer <azarah@gentoo.org>: 54 19 Oct 2003; Martin Schlemmer <azarah@gentoo.org>:
6 55
7 More bootsplash fixes, bug #21019 (comment #21). 56 More bootsplash fixes, bug #21019 (comment #21).
8 57

Legend:
Removed from v.1.281  
changed lines
  Added in v.1.292

  ViewVC Help
Powered by ViewVC 1.1.20